Pinnacle for a long time allowed bots. This rule is specifically for bot users. I actually suggested to pinnacle customer service they should disallow people from using any automated betting software or bots and they proudly replied that their volume and their system can handle anything and there was no reason for them to disallow them. I didn't like that decision. That was years ago.
Now, they finally made a rule against it. I am happy.
Those bot users beat the good line almost every time. Most of them use bots for arb purposes.
I don't like racing against bots to get the best line. This new rule is golden and should have happened long time ago.
I am guessing their volume is not as good anymore to support bot activity.
